list of parts in Air cooled oil cooler

These are the essential parts responsible for transferring heat from the oil to the air.

  1. Core / Fin Block: The heart of the cooler. It consists of:
    1. Tubes: Flattened or round tubes that the hot oil flows through. They are typically made of aluminum (for lightweight and efficiency) or copper.
    1. Fins: Thin sheets of metal (almost always aluminum) layered between the tubes. Their large surface area absorbs heat from the tubes and efficiently transfers it to the passing air.
    1. Headers / Tanks: Larger diameter tubes or castings on the sides or ends of the core. They distribute the oil from the inlet to all the smaller tubes and collect it from the tubes to the outlet. They are often made of aluminum or brass.

Optional & Auxiliary Components

  1. Temperature Switch / Sensor: Often screwed into a port in the header to monitor oil temperature and control the electric fan (turning it on/off as needed).
  2. Pressure Relief Valve: A safety feature to protect the core from extreme pressure spikes.
  3. Protective Screen / Guard: A mesh or wire screen placed over the air inlet or outlet side to prevent large debris from damaging the delicate fins.
  4. Anodized Coating: A hard, protective layer on aluminum cores (often black) that improves corrosion resistance and increases heat radiation.
